Takuya Ban is a scholar working on Plant Science, Molecular Biology and Food Science. According to data from OpenAlex, Takuya Ban has authored 43 papers receiving a total of 694 ind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Plant Science, 15 papers in Molecular Biology and 7 papers in Food Science. Recurrent topics in Takuya Ban’s work include Horticultural and Viticultural Research (8 papers), Growth and nutrition in plants (7 papers) and Phytochemicals and Antioxidant Activities (7 papers). Takuya Ban is often cited by papers focused on Horticultural and Viticultural Research (8 papers), Growth and nutrition in plants (7 papers) and Phytochemicals and Antioxidant Activities (7 papers). Takuya Ban collaborates with scholars based in Japan, Bangladesh and South Korea. Takuya Ban's co-authors include Toshiki Asao, Nami Goto‐Yamamoto, Megumi Ishimaru, Shozo Kobayashi, H. Kitazawa, M. H. R. Pramanik, Nobuo Kobayashi, Yasuhisa Kunimi, Madoka Nakai and Takashi Hosoki and has published in prestigious journals such as The Science of The Total Environment, Frontiers in Plant Science and Japanese Journal of Applied Physics.
